WebThe Five Common Topics - Comparison, Definition, Circumstance, Relation, and Testimony - are places we go to gather information, from the Greek word, "topos", place. Canon (s) The three fundamental activities of writing. They are Invention, Arrangement, and Elocution. Cause The actions, events, etc., that cause brought about the situation. The first of the Five Canons of Rhetoric is invention. This is the stage when a student decides what to say before sitting down to write their speech or essay.
